Lupe Fiasco Concert Live at House Of Blues | San Diego – May 17th, 2026
House of Blues in San Diego is one of those venues that really feels like the heartbeat of the local music scene. It’s often a must-stop for national acts on tour, meaning you get a chance to see big names like The Black Keys or Dave Matthews Band right in town. There’s something special about catching a show there, especially since they put a lot of effort into ensuring every performance sounds just right, thanks to their meticulous soundcheck process. The vibe is pretty electric from the moment you walk in, with mezzanine seats offering a killer view and accessible areas that make everyone feel welcome. Plus, the venue hosts cool events like their annual Black History Month celebrations, which really highlight African American music and culture. And let’s be honest, it’s conveniently close to San Diego’s historic Gaslamp District, so grabbing a bite or a drink before or after a show is super easy. If you’re heading to see Lupe Fiasco in San Diego, this place is definitely a spot to keep in mind, it’s more than just a concert hall, it’s an experience that sticks with you.
